BIOTIN
One of the best known vitamins for promoting hair growth, Biotin (a B-complex also known as vitamin H) helps to metabolise fats and proteins, and is essential for strengthening hair and nails. If you are deficient in it, you can experience dry, brittle nails and thinning and lacklustre hair prone to breakage. Biotin produces keratin, and assists elasticity in the cortex layer of the hair shaft, so your hair is less prone to damage from heat styling, sun damage and other dangers. Chow down on eggs, seafood, brown rice, yeast, oats and lentils.
SELENIUM
A deficiency in the mineral selenium can inhibit your body's ability to grow new hair. It is known to help combat the fungal infection malassezia, which is associated with dandruff or scalp psoriasis, and is therefore a common ingredient in anti-dandruff shampoos. Fish, whole grains and garlic are a source of selenium in your diet.

ZINC
Zinc is a vital mineral essential to maintaining a healthy immune system. It promotes healthy hair follicles and therefore can lead to weakened follicles resulting in hair loss if you are deficient. Zinc is key in cell reproduction, maintaining hormone levels and absorbing vitamins. Some studies have shown that zinc can prevent or slow graying hair. Oysters, sweet potato, nuts, chickpeas and spinach are all rich in zinc.

VITAMIN B6
In addition to energy and red blood cell production, vitamin B6 keeps hair healthy. It also helps to keep skin healthy too, as it increases collagen production. This is necessary for hair growth. Tuna, bananas, salmon and spinach are excellent sources of B6.
VITAMIN B12
Vitamin B12 promotes healthy hair growth by helping in the formation of red blood cells. The visible part of your hair is made up of keratin which is a protein. At the base of each hair follicle, tiny blood vessels connect to the root of each hair strand. Red blood cells carry oxygen to the living portion of the hair strands. Without adequate oxygen, your hair typically won’t be able to sustain healthy growth so it’s important to have adequate levels of Vitamin B12
PANTOTHENTIC ACID / VITAMIN B5
Pantothenic acid is believed to help strengthen hair follicles and their cells, allowing them to function properly. One study even found that taking the nutrient stops hair from thinning. The nutrient, also known as Vitamin B5 can be found in cauliflower,avocado, legumes, lentils, egg yolks, broccoli, tomatoes among other things.
